Give me an example of radiant energy
krek1111 [17]
Virtually anything that has a temperature gives off radiant energy. Some examples of radiant energy include: The heat emitted from a campfire Emission of heat from a hot sidewalk X-rays give off radiant energy Microwaves utilize radiant energy Space heaters produce radiant energy Heat created by the body can be radiant energy
